Each unit on the NT5K17BA DDI card operates as a DDI trunk. Table 3-8
presents a summary of NT5K17BA DDI trunk card signalling states.
Idle State
When the central office presents a high impedance of 8.5K ohms or greater to
the DDI unit, the NT5K17BA DDI trunk card is in the idle state. Ground is
present on the tip wire and negative battery (-50V) is present on the ring wire.
Seize
The central office initiates a call by placing a low resistance loop (2.2 K ohms
or less) across the tip and ring leads. The increased current flow will trigger
a front end detector on the Option 11. A message is sent to the Central
Processing Unit (CPU), and the microprocessor prepares for receipt of
dialling digits. A seizure acknowledge signal is sent to the central office
within 150 milliseconds.
